Transaction e05d5ed9ec6df10312523f42595623ccf1e943108f8a35dbb45a1b017c2d2b54

70 Input
1 Outputs
  • e05d5ed9ec6df10312523f42595623ccf1e943108f8a35dbb45a1b017c2d2b54:0
  • value  2605396
    address  3HPF1x3g34oeiakfmrUb8Ej6mbWSj8CpZc